
Football opens up fall practice
7/27/2017 2:29:00 PM | Football
HUNTSVILLE – The Sam Houston State Bearkats kicked off preparations for the upcoming 2017 season on Thursday morning, opening up fall camp at Bowers Stadium.
The Kats kick off the season on August 27 against Richmond, and thus are one of the first teams in the nation to open fall practice. The team reported to camp on Monday with position meetings being conducted each day this week, along with other orientation items and meetings leading up to the opening of practice.
Coach K.C. Keeler's squad will have five practices before going live for the first time on August 1 with three scrimmages currently scheduled for August 7, August 13 and August 17. In all, there will be 21 practices leading up to game week against the Spiders.
“We've had a good week of meetings and kind of setting the schedule for what we are going to be doing,” Keeler said. “These first few practices are all about the newcomers and getting them familiar with our schedule and how we go about things.”
Over 100 players have reported to camp, including eight starters from last year's record-setting offense that averaged 49.5 points per game.
The season opener against Richmond is set for a 6 p.m. kickoff at Bowers Stadium on August 27 and will be a national broadcast, aired live on ESPNU.
